7-Day Honeymoon Itinerary in South India

Sunday, November 26: Arrival in Chennai

Start your honeymoon in Chennai, the capital city of Tamil Nadu. In the morning, visit Marina Beach, the second-longest urban beach in the world, and take a romantic walk along the shoreline. In the afternoon, explore Fort St. George, a historic fortress that houses the St. Mary's Church and the Fort Museum. As the evening sets in, enjoy a sunset cruise on the Chennai coastline.

  • Marina Beach: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Fort St. George: Estimated Cost - INR 50,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Sunset Cruise: Estimated Cost - INR 1,500, Time Spent - 2 hours
Monday, November 27: Explore Puducherry

Start your day by traveling to Puducherry, a charming coastal town known for its French influence. In the morning, visit the Aurobindo Ashram, a spiritual community founded by Sri Aurobindo and the Mother. In the afternoon, discover the French Quarter, with its beautiful colonial architecture and quaint cafes. As the evening sets in, enjoy a romantic dinner at a beachside restaurant.

  • Aurobindo Ashram: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• French Quarter: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 3 hours
  • Beachside Dinner: Estimated Cost - INR 2,500, Time Spent - 2 hours
Tuesday, November 28: Majestic Mysore

Travel to Mysore, a city known for its royal heritage and architectural marvels. In the morning, visit the magnificent Mysore Palace, a stunning example of Indo-Saracenic architecture. In the afternoon, explore the vibrant Devaraja Market, where you can find spices, silk sarees, and local handicrafts. As the evening sets in, witness the grandeur of the illuminated Mysore Palace.

  • Mysore Palace: Estimated Cost - INR 200,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Devaraja Market: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Illuminated Mysore Palace: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1 hour
Wednesday, November 29: Serene Wayanad

Head to Wayanad, a tranquil hill station nestled amidst the Western Ghats. In the morning, visit the beautiful Banasura Sagar Dam, the largest earthen dam in India. In the afternoon, explore the lush tea plantations and indulge in a tea tasting experience. As the evening sets in, take a romantic stroll through the tranquil Pookode Lake.

  • Banasura Sagar Dam: Estimated Cost - INR 20,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Tea Plantations and Tasting: Estimated Cost - INR 500, Time Spent - 3 hours
  • Pookode Lake: Estimated Cost - INR 30, Time Spent - 2 hours
Thursday, November 30: Backwaters of Alleppey

Travel to Alleppey, known as the Venice of the East, famous for its backwaters and houseboat cruises. In the morning, embark on a private houseboat and enjoy a scenic cruise through the tranquil backwaters, surrounded by lush greenery. In the afternoon, indulge in a traditional Kerala lunch prepared on the houseboat. As the evening sets in, witness a mesmerizing sunset over the backwaters.

  • Houseboat Cruise: Estimated Cost - INR 8,000, Time Spent - 6 hours
  • Traditional Kerala Lunch: Estimated Cost - INR 500,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Sunset Over Backwaters: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1 hour
Friday, December 1: Cultural Kochi

Head to Kochi, a city renowned for its rich cultural heritage and colonial architecture. In the morning, visit the iconic Chinese Fishing Nets, unique fishing techniques introduced by Chinese traders. In the afternoon, explore the historic Fort Kochi area, filled with charming colonial buildings, art galleries, and cafes. As the evening sets in, watch a traditional Kathakali dance performance.

  • Chinese Fishing Nets: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Fort Kochi: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 3 hours
  • Kathakali Dance Performance: Estimated Cost - INR 500, Time Spent - 2 hours
Saturday, December 2: Blissful Kanyakumari

Travel to Kanyakumari, the southernmost tip of the Indian mainland. In the morning, visit the Vivekananda Rock Memorial, situated on a rocky island, accessible by a ferry ride. In the afternoon, explore the Thiruvalluvar Statue, dedicated to the famous Tamil poet. As the evening sets in, witness the breathtaking sunset over the confluence of three seas.

  • Vivekananda Rock Memorial: Estimated Cost - INR 200, Time Spent - 3 hours
  • Thiruvalluvar Statue: Estimated Cost - INR 30,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Sunset at Kanyakumari: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1 hour

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ique experience, explore the lesser-known hill station of Yelagiri in Tamil Nadu. Enjoy the tranquility of the hills, go for a nature walk, and indulge in adventure activities like paragliding. Another off the beaten path destination is the serene village of Kumarakom in Kerala, known for its backwaters and bird sanctuary. Stay in a traditional houseboat and immerse yourself in the peaceful surroundings.
